Synthesis, Crystal Structure and Antimicrobial Study of a New Schiff Base 2-{ (2′-Benzyl)iminoethyl}-5-methoxyphenol

         

摘要

cqvip:The Schiff base, 2-{(2-benzyl)iminoethyl}-5-methoxyphenol (C6H4CH2N=C(CH3)C6H3- (OMe-5)OH) 1, was synthesized and characterized by elemental analysis, IR and X-ray single-crystal di- ffraction. The compound crystallizes in the orthorhombic system, space group Pbca with a = 8.9849(10), b = 13.2699(15), c = 22.975(2) , V = 2739.3(5) 3, Mr = 255.31, Z = 8, F(000) = 1088, Dc = 1.238 g/cm3, T = 293 K, μ = 0.082 mm-1, λ = 0.71073 , the final R = 0.0596 and wR = 0.1575 for 1934 observed reflections with I > 2σ(I). The complex was valued for its antimicrobial activity against bacterial strands using the agar diffusion method, and found to be active against the four test bacterial organisms.
